For the eclectic or noncommittal student, a general studies program can work wonders because it allows them to sample courses from several different majors. This academic smorgasbord can help illuminate areas of interest that students were not even aware they had.

An MA is a master’s degree awarded to students that have completed a program studying humanities or fine arts subjects such as history, communications, philosophy, theology or English. A Master of Arts degree typically requires coursework, research and written examinations.
